What is the surface area of the rectangular prism shown above?​

Answers

Answer:

The surface area of the rectangular prism is [tex]160in^2[/tex].

Step-by-step explanation:

The surface area of a 3-dimensional shape is found by adding the area of each side of the shape together. In this case, the areas of each side of the rectangular prism are 20 in, 20 in, 50 in, 50 in, 10 in, and 10 in. Find the surface area by adding each area together and you'll get [tex](50*2)+(20*2)+(10*2)=100+40+20=160in^2[/tex].

Find the length and width of a similar rectangular screen if the length is 5 meters more than 6 times its width, and the viewable area is 5,550 square meters.

Answers

Answer:185 m , 60 m

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

Length is 5 m more than 6 times its width

Suppose width is [tex]x[/tex]

So, length is given by [tex]6x+5[/tex]

The area is given by [tex]l\times b[/tex]

Put values of length and width

[tex]\Rightarrow (6x+5)x=5550\\\Rightarrow 6x^2+5x-5550=0\\[/tex]

On solving the quadratic equation, we get [tex]x=30[/tex]

Length is [tex]6\times 30+5=185\ m[/tex]

Width is [tex]x=30\ m[/tex]

At a basketball​ game, a team made 55 successful shots. They were a combination of​ 1- and​ 2-point shots. The team scored 92 points in all. Write and solve a system of equations to find the number of each type of shot.

Answers

There were 18 one point shots and 37 two point shots.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the number of one point shots be x and the number of two point shots be y .

So we have the system:

x + y = 55

x + 2y = 92

Subtract the first equation from the second, we get:

0 + y = 92 - 55 = 37.  

y = 37.

From equation 1 we have x = 55 - y

therefore x = 55 - 37 = 18.
